Responsibilities

  • Lead the environmental compliance for the project.

  • Identify, assess, and reduce environmental risks to the company.

  • Update environmental plans.

  • Perform and oversee field inspections (stormwater, SPCC, waste accumulation).

  • Implement waste management plan and communicate responsibilities to project team and subcontractors.

  • Maintaining project waste diversion data tracking requirements.

  • Identify wetland and sensitive environmental areas for protection and fencing in advance of construction activities.

  • Monitor, forecast and communicate environmental costs at the project level.

  • Develop and conduct environmental protection and awareness training to staff at all levels.

  • Function as a principal technical advisor and coordinator for environmental issues.

  • Prepare project and Kiewit required reports and communication of environmental risks to project management.

  • Liaise with the client providing them weekly/monthly reports as required and ensuring they are aware of any unanticipated discoveries, incidents, and compliance issues.
